Introduction to Priority Pass: Enhancing Your Airport Experience
Priority Pass is a global network of over 1,500 airport lounges designed to elevate your travel experience, offering a serene retreat from the hustle and bustle of airport terminals. Whether you’re a frequent flyer or an occasional traveler, Priority Pass lounges provide a comfortable space to relax, work, or enjoy complimentary amenities like snacks, drinks, and Wi-Fi. Access to these lounges is available through various means, including membership plans and premium credit cards, making it easier than ever to enhance your journey.
What to Expect in a Priority Pass Lounge: Amenities and Comfort
Upon entering a Priority Pass lounge, you can expect a wide range of amenities tailored to enhance your comfort. Many lounges offer comfortable seating, including cozy chairs, sofas, and semi-private areas for families or those needing a quiet space to work. Complimentary food and beverages are standard, with options ranging from simple snacks and soft drinks to more elaborate spreads including sandwiches, wine, and beer in fancier locations. High-end lounges may even provide full buffets and extensive bar selections. Additionally, some lounges offer unique amenities such as private showers, spa treatments like massages and manicures, nap pods, and dedicated workspaces with phone booths for privacy. These perks make your layover or pre-flight experience more enjoyable and rejuvenating.
How to Access a Priority Pass Lounge: A Straightforward Process
Accessing a Priority Pass lounge is a seamless process. To begin, you can use the Priority Pass app to locate lounges at your current airport, complete with directions to each location. Upon arrival at the lounge, present your Priority Pass membership card or digital barcode, along with your boarding pass and a form of ID. If your membership is linked to a credit card, you may also need to show that card. Keep in mind that some lounges may allow guests, though policies vary, and you may incur additional fees depending on your membership type. Be sure to check in early, as lounges can fill up quickly, and you wouldn’t want to miss your flight due to a prolonged stay.
Obtaining Priority Pass Membership: Direct Purchase and Credit Card Options
Priority Pass offers flexible membership options to suit different travel needs. You can purchase a Standard membership for $99 annually, with a $35 fee per visit for you and any guests. The Standard Plus plan, priced at $329 a year, includes 10 annual visits, with additional visits costing $35 each. For unlimited access, the Prestige plan is available for $469 annually, with guests charged at $35 per visit. Alternatively, several premium credit cards offer complimentary Priority Pass memberships as a perk. These include the Amex Platinum, Chase Sapphire Reserve, and Capital One Venture X, among others. These credit cards not only provide lounge access but also offer additional travel benefits, making them a valuable choice for frequent travelers.
Top Credit Cards Offering Priority Pass Benefits: A Detailed Overview
The American Express Platinum Card, for instance, offers unlimited lounge visits and allows you to bring up to two complimentary guests per visit. It also grants access to Amex Centurion Lounges and up to 10 Delta Sky Club visits annually when flying Delta. The Chase Sapphire Reserve, with a $550 annual fee, provides similar benefits, including Priority Pass membership and the ability to bring up to two guests. The Capital One Venture X Rewards Credit Card stands out as an affordable option at $395 annually, offering Priority Pass access for yourself and up to two guests, with the ability to add up to four authorized users at no extra cost. Each of these cards offers unique perks, making them excellent choices for travelers seeking elevated airport experiences.
Frequently Asked Questions About Priority Pass: Addressing Common Queries
For those new to Priority Pass, several questions often arise. Membership activation doesn’t happen immediately; you’ll need to register for a Priority Pass account and wait for your membership card to arrive, which can take a few days. You can access your digital Priority Pass card via the app under the "Membership Card" tab once you’ve created an account. Generally, you can bring guests to Priority Pass lounges, but policies vary by lounge and membership type, with many credit card programs allowing up to two free guests. If a lounge is full, you may be placed on a waitlist and notified when space becomes available. As you plan your visit, be mindful of your flight schedule to avoid missing your boarding time.
